first of all, guys may not want to read this question.

so swimsuit season is coming and i shaved my, umm, area down under. i have before i didnt get much razor burn at all but this time it is HORRIBLE! two days since i have shaved and i just noticed the ENTIRE area is red and bumpy and i have seen it before but this time is bad! it looks like a million spider bites, it hurts and itches! how do i get rid of these bumps? it looks like a freaking disease but i know it isn't i never had sex or anything.

please answer fast this is starting to scare me! (link)
There's some 'no bumps' stuff you can get at a grocery store, near the Skintimate and things like that. I haven't used that, but it might help. Some things I'd try are 1)Warm washcloth compresses 2) Unscented lotion 3) over-the-counter cortisone cream (keep it away from your introitus (opening) and off the inner lips 4) Keep clean otherwise, using Vagisil wipes or just warm water.

A good thing to know is that razor quality DOES count. I use Mach III (even though it's a men's razor). I will never again use a disposable. They do a horrible job and leave me looking butchered.
